The Cummins InCal Tool V7 is the seventh version of the InCal Tool software. This version offers advanced features and improvements over its predecessors, providing users with enhanced functionality and ease of use. The tool is designed to work with a range of Cummins engines, including diesel and natural gas engines, and supports various ECMs, including the CM2150, CM2250, CM2350, and others. Create a template of the existing ECM configuration before flashing. This saves specific customer parameters like gear ratios, cruise control speed limits, and PTO settings.
